An aetiological model for understanding sexual function and dysfunction.
| Predisposing factors | Detail |
|---|---|
| Anatomical deformities, e.g. intersex conditions | |
| Hormonal irregularities | |
| Temperament; shyness vs. impulsivity; inhibition/excitation | |
| Physical resiliency | |
| Personality traits, e.g., obsessive-compulsive vs. histrionic | |
| Problematical attachment/experiences with parents or parental surrogates | |
| Exposure to physical, sexual coercion, violence | |
| Surgical intervention/medical illness | |
| Event based or process-based trauma | |
| Early sexual experiences, e.g. first intercourse | |
| Sexual abuse | |
| Religious/cultural messages, expectations, constraints | |
| Life-stage stressors such as divorce, separation, loss of partner, infidelity, menopausal complaints | |
| Infertility or postpartum experiences | |
| Humiliating sexual encounters/experiences | |
| Depression/anxiety | |
| Relationship discord | |
| Substance abuse | |
| Ongoing interpersonal conflict | |
| Stress-emotional, occupational, personal | |
| Acute/chronic illness/health problems | |
| Medications, substance abuse | |
| Loss of sexual self-confidence, performance anxiety | |
| Body image concerns | |
| Present day stresses and demands; financial burdens, unemployment, care-taking of parents | |
| Children or partner, fatigue from child-rearing | |
| Environmental constraints; lack of privacy, time, partners working different shifts | |
| Repeated unsuccessful attempts to conceive children, artificially assisted attempts to conceive | |
